Proper care ensures longevity and maintains appearance.
Cleaning: Wipe frame with a damp cloth and mild detergent. Dry immediately. Clean seat with a dry or slightly damp cloth; avoid excessive water.
Maintenance: Periodically check and tighten screws.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ents.
Storage: Store in a dry place. When stacking, ensure chairs are clean and dry.
CAUTION! Do not use harsh chemicals; they may damage the finish. Avoid direct sunlight to prevent fading.
Designed for indoor use on stable, level floors.
Tip: For even wear, occasionally rotate chair position if used daily.
Chairs are designed for efficient storage by stacking.
WARNING! Do not stack more than 6 chairs. Ensure stack is stable and not leaning.

| Issue |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Chair wobbles | Loose screws | Tighten all screws with Allen key. |
| Seat squeaks | Wood rubbing on frame | Check alignment; loosen and re-tighten screws evenly. |
| Difficulty stacking | Misalignment or dirt | Clean contact points; ensure chairs are aligned front-to-back. |
| Scratches on frame | Rough handling | Use touch-up paint (available from IKEA) for small scratches. |
| Protective caps pop out | Not fully inserted | Press firmly until flush; ensure screw is tight underneath. |
Note: For persistent issues, disassemble and reassemble following instructions.
